Explore the architectural beauty and vast literary treasures of the Detroit Main Library, a cultural landmark in the heart of Michigan.
The Detroit Main Library is a stunning architectural masterpiece that offers a rich cultural experience for tourists. Situated in the heart of Detroit, this monumental building is not just a library but a beacon of knowledge and history. With its intricate design and vast collection of books, art, and resources, it invites visitors to explore and appreciate the beauty of literature and architecture alike. Step inside to discover not only a treasure trove of information but also a welcoming atmosphere that celebrates learning and community.
